About the Park
Kern County Dog Park gives dogs an off-leash place to stretch out in Ridgecrest, a high-desert city in the Indian Wells Valley of eastern Kern County. It is free to visit as a public park. Ridgecrest sits at elevation in an arid desert environment, which means hot summer days, cool nights, and strong sun much of the year, so early morning and evening visits are easier on both dogs and owners. Carry water and watch surface temperatures on warm afternoons. Fencing status and posted hours are not confirmed in our records, so check the setup when you arrive before unclipping a leash. For Ridgecrest-area residents, it is a straightforward local option for daily dog exercise.

backpackWhat to Bring
Fresh water and a bowl
Even parks with water fountains can have them out of service. Bring your own to be safe.
Poop bags
Most parks provide them, but don't rely on it. Always come prepared to clean up after your dog.
A folding chair
This park may have limited seating, so a portable chair can make longer visits more comfortable.
A reflective collar or light-up leash
If you visit near dusk, visibility gear helps you keep track of your dog and stay safe.
High-value treats
Useful for practicing recall in a distracting environment and rewarding good social behavior.
Your dog's favorite toy
A familiar toy can help shy dogs feel more comfortable and give them something to focus on.
